Nothing beats an old classic shredded chicken taco with savory sliced onions and a chile sauce. Topped with two eggs over medium, tomato sauce, crema Mexicans, and a dash of cilantro- this dish had excellent texture with a nice contrast of soft and crispy brought about by the eggs and chips, respectively. Smothered in cheese and salsa, the chilaquiles are flavors galore. Out of all sauces, we highly recommend the classic red salsa. Consistently delicious, this dish will blow you away.
